    Hjá Jóni is a Reykjavík venue with a clear verified signal: Star Wine List recognition in 2026. Beyond that recognition, the available verified details are limited, so it is best approached without assuming a specific cuisine, chef narrative, menu format, price point, or special service style.

    Use the confirmed basics to decide whether it fits your plan. Hjá Jóni is open daily, with weekday hours from 11:30 AM to 9:30 PM and weekend hours from 12 PM to 9:30 PM. The dress code is smart casual.
